A 44.3-kg block of ice at 0 oC is sliding on a horizontal surface. The initial speed of 033 the ice is 6.68 m/s and the final speed is 2.25 m/s. change in K.E= heat gain
1/2*m*v^2 - 1/2 *m*u^2 = m_ice*L_fusion
1/2*44.3*6.68^2 - 1/2*44.3*2.25^2 = m_ice*3.33*10^5
==> m_ice=2.63*10^-3 kg
